单片机编程数字电源是什么

单片机编程数字电源是什么

单片机编程数字电源是利用单片机的高速计算和控制能力来实现电源输出参数(如电压、电流)的精确控制与调整的系统。这种电源广泛应用于高精度和可编程性要求的应用场景,如实验室测试、生产线自动化以及高科技产品研发等。其中,利用单片机驱动和控制的转换效率高、响应速度快、稳定性强的特点,能够确保电源输出的稳定性与可靠性。

一、工作原理分析

单片机编程数字电源主要由模拟电源部分、单片机控制核心、人机界面和通信接口等部分组成。工作时,单片机接收到来自操作者的指令后,通过内部PWM(脉冲宽度调制)或者其他数字信号处理方式输出控制信号,进一步控制功率调节模块来精确调整输出电压和电流。

二、关键技术点剖析

编程技术是单片机编程数字电源的核心。程序的稳定性和灵活性对系统的性能影响巨大。单片机通过编程,可以实现串行通信控制、模拟信号采集、数字信号处理等关键功能,这些使单片机在电源管理中发挥出重要作用。

三、应用场景与优势归纳

单片机编程数字电源常见于实验室精密仪器供电、工业控制系统、电子产品老化测试等多个领域。其中精确的电压和电流调节能力,以及良好的编程灵活性是它在这些应用场景中得以广泛使用的原因。

四、设计与开发流程

开发单片机编程数字电源需要经过以下几个重要步骤:需求分析、系统设计、程序编写与调试、系统集成与测试。在这一过程中,对电路设计、程序稳定运行和系统优化进行综合考量是关键。

五、面临的挑战与解决方案

尽管单片机编程数字电源具有众多优势,但在设计和应用过程中,仍然会遇到一些技术挑战,如干扰问题、热管理、软件的可靠性等。通过合理设计电路布局、选择合适的散热方案和采用严格的软件测试流程,可以有效解决上述问题,提升电源性能。

六、未来发展趋势

未来,随着电子技术和计算机技术的发展,单片机编程数字电源将趋向于更智能化、高效化和集成化。例如,通过整合人工智能算法,可以实现更为精细的电源管理和故障预判;而功率电子技术的进步将进一步提高系统的能效和功率密度。

相关问答FAQs:

单片机编程数字电源是指通过单片机对数字电源进行编程控制的一种电源系统。它结合了单片机和数字电源的特点,通过编程控制单片机的输出信号来实现对数字电源的调节和控制。单片机编程数字电源的出现,为电力系统的控制和管理提供了更高效、更智能的解决方案。

什么是数字电源?

数字电源是与传统模拟电源相对应的一种新型电源设计理念。它采用数字信号进行控制和调节,具有高精度、高稳定性、高效率等特点。数字电源通常通过内置的硬件和软件进行数字控制,可以实现对电压、电流、功率等参数的精确调节和监测。相比传统模拟电源,数字电源具有更好的可靠性和可控性。

单片机编程数字电源的工作原理是什么?

单片机编程数字电源的工作原理主要分为三个步骤:传感器采集、单片机控制和数字电源输出。

首先,通过传感器采集电源输入端的各种参数,如输入电压、电流、温度等。这些参数将作为反馈信号传给单片机。

然后,单片机根据采集到的反馈信号进行数据处理和分析,通过编程算法计算出相应的控制参数,例如输出电压和电流的设定值。

最后,单片机通过输出端口将控制参数发送给数字电源,数字电源根据接收到的信号进行相应的调节,输出符合设定值的电压和电流。

通过单片机编程数字电源的工作原理,我们可以实现对电源系统的智能控制和精确调节,提高电能的利用效率和稳定性。

单片机编程数字电源有哪些应用领域?

单片机编程数字电源在各个领域都有着广泛的应用,特别是对于需要精密控制和稳定输出的场合。

在工业自动化领域,单片机编程数字电源可以用于自动化生产线上的电力供应和控制,实时监测和调节输出电压和电流,保证设备的正常运行和生产效率的提升。

在电子仪器领域,单片机编程数字电源可以用于高精度的测试仪器,例如示波器、频谱仪等,保证仪器输出的稳定性和精确度。

在通信设备领域,单片机编程数字电源可以用于手机、电视、电脑等设备的电力管理,提供稳定可靠的电源供应。

总之,单片机编程数字电源由于其高精度、高稳定性和高可靠性等特点,在各个领域都有着广泛的应用前景。通过编程控制,可以实现电源系统的智能化管理,提高电力的利用效率和设备的性能。

文章标题:单片机编程数字电源是什么,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/1627877

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 编程scratch为什么不学了

    学习编程语言SCRATCH的五个主要理由是:1、启蒙儿童理解编程概念、2、培养逻辑思维和解决问题的能力、3、促进创造力和想象力、4、提供实践性强的学习环境、5、作为其他编程语言的跳板。一个值得特别展开的理由是培养孩子的逻辑思维和解决问题的能力。通过拖放编程块组合成代码,孩子们可以学会如何顺序安排任务…

    2024年5月7日
    700
  • 什么编程用得最多

    JavaScript、Python、和Java是目前使用最广泛的编程语言。这几种语言各自占据着特定的领域,其中JavaScript的普及率最高。它是构建现代网页和开发服务器端应用程序的首选语言,凭借其能够在浏览器端运行的独特优势,成为了前端开发的标配。除此之外,JavaScript的生态系统极为丰富…

    2024年5月2日
    2500
  • hello编程学的是什么

    编程学的是如何编写计算机程序,即通过特定的编程语言来实现某项功能或解决特定问题的过程。此过程包括理解问题、设计解决方案、编写代码、测试和调试程序、以及维护和更新代码。 在详细描述中,编写代码 是实现这些目标的核心步骤。它涉及将问题的解决方案转化为可以被计算机理解和执行的指令集。这些指令必须遵循所使用…

    2024年5月7日
    900
  • xeon编程是什么

    Xeon编程是指在具有英特尔Xeon处理器的计算平台上进行的程序开发和优化。开发人员利用Xeon处理器的多核和多线程能力,以提高数据处理和计算性能。Xeon处理器广泛应用于服务器、工作站和高性能计算 (HPC) 环境。针对Xeon处理器进行编程,通常需要对并行编程有深入了解,并能够使用相关工具和技术…

    2024年5月2日
    3700
  • pac编程是什么

    PAC编程是指采用可编程自动化控制器(Programmable Automation Controller)进行的编程工作。1、它结合了传统PLC的可靠性与专用控制器的灵活性;2、具备较强的数据处理能力;3、可在多工业领域内实现复杂控制任务。其中,数据处理能力突出,使PAC能够更好地应对大量数据处理…

    2024年5月2日
    3200
  • Saas应该如何立足中国的企业服务

    Saas应该如何立足中国的企业服务:1、SaaS服务可以降低企业的成本;2、SaaS软件推动企业信息化管理进程;3、SaaS产品无需企业维护和管理;4、使用SaaS软件无需额外付费;5、SaaS定价灵活,符合企业的发展模式。使用SaaS服务可以为企业节省大量成本。 一、SaaS服务可以降低企业的成本…

    2023年4月30日
    29400
  • 编程境界是什么

    在提升代码技术水平上,达到编程境界通常意味着思维深度与广度以及解决问题的能力的全面提升。1、深厚的编程基础理解;2、高效的解决问题能力;3、不断的创新和学习;4、良好的团队合作精神和沟通能力。 在深厚的编程基础理解这一方面,编程不仅仅是编写代码那么简单,真正的编程境界在于对编程语言的深入了解、对计算…

    2024年5月2日
    2400
  • 主观编程题是什么意思

    主观编程题指的是一种需要程序员根据题目描述编写程序代码,但没有一个确定的、自动化的评分参考的编程题目。在这种类型的题目中,解决问题的方法可能有多种,不同的解决方案可能都是正确的。程序代码由考官或评估系统根据代码的功能、效率、可读性和创新性等方面主观进行打分。 在传统的客观编程题中,常常有标准的输入输…

    2024年4月27日
    4400
  • 项目如何做好风险管理

    项目风险管理是确保项目成功的关键组成部分。识别风险、评估风险、制定风险应对策略、以及定期复审和调整风险管理计划是进行有效风险管理的四个基本步骤。特别地,识别风险是所有步骤中的首要任务,因为只有准确识别了潜在的风险,项目团队才能针对性地制定出有效的应对措施。 识别风险过程包括使用不同的工具和技术来确定…

    2024年4月10日
    10300
  • 项目该如何开展管理

    项目管理是一个复杂的过程,它涉及多个阶段,包括项目启动、计划、执行、监控和关闭。有效的项目管理应确保项目按时、在预算范围内以及具有预期品质完成。首先,必须定义项目目标和目的;其次,关键利益相关者应当被识别并纳入沟通计划中;接着,项目的范围、时间和成本需被明确规划并监控;此外,质量管理和风险管理也应贯…

    2024年4月10日
    7500

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部